Blade Tidwell addresses back tightness in outing in Giants' huge loss to Rockies

Giants pitcher Blade Tidwell speaks to reporters following San Francisco's 13-7 loss against the Colorado Rockies on Sunday at Oracle Park.

Blade Tidwell addresses back tightness in outing in Giants' huge loss to Rockies originally appeared on NBC Sports Bay Area
